How to adjust the speed of CNC circular saw machine

As a modern cutting equipment, CNC circular saw machine is widely used in the precise cutting of various materials such as wood, metal, plastic, etc. Compared with traditional manual sawing, CNC circular saw machine has higher precision and stronger stability, which can greatly improve production efficiency and work quality. When using CNC circular saw machine, how to adjust the speed of CNC circular saw machine is a very important link, which directly affects the cutting effect and the service life of the equipment. Correctly adjusting the speed can not only improve the cutting efficiency, but also ensure the cutting quality of the material, avoid excessive wear of the equipment, and extend its service life.

The speed adjustment of CNC circular saw machine usually depends on the settings of CNC system. Different materials, cutting requirements and types of tools require different speeds to achieve the best cutting effect. For example, for wood, a lower speed may have a better cutting effect, because wood is softer, and too high a speed may cause cracks or uneven cutting. For metal materials, especially metals with higher hardness, higher speeds are usually required to ensure the smoothness and precision of cutting. First of all, we should know that the speed adjustment of CNC circular saw machines is usually controlled by the CNC system or the operation panel. The speed setting in the CNC system will be adjusted accordingly according to different processing requirements. For beginners or operators who are not familiar with CNC equipment, it is usually recommended to refer to the speed range provided in the equipment manual or the processing manual to select the appropriate speed for adjustment. Most CNC circular saw machines have preset speed gears, which can be simply selected according to the type of material, thickness and cutting requirements.

However, how to adjust the speed of CNC circular saw machines is not fixed. It needs to be dynamically adjusted according to specific operating requirements and use environment. For example, when cutting thicker materials, in order to ensure the cutting quality, the speed is appropriately lowered to avoid excessive cutting heat and prevent the cutting parts from deforming or appearing. When high-speed cutting is performed, increasing the speed will help improve work efficiency, but it is necessary to ensure that the cooling system can work normally to prevent overheating from affecting the cutting effect.

When adjusting the speed of the CNC circular saw machine, the user also needs to consider the adaptability of the tool. Different types of tools have different requirements for speed. Too high a speed may cause premature wear of the tool and affect the cutting quality. Especially in the cutting process of hard materials, the material and design of the tool usually need to support high speed, and low-quality tools may easily break or deform at high speed. Therefore, choosing a tool suitable for the material and adjusting the speed according to the specifications and material properties of the tool is the key to ensuring high-efficiency cutting.

In addition, how to adjust the speed of the CNC circular saw machine is also closely related to the performance of the equipment itself. High-quality CNC circular saw machines are usually equipped with a drive system and speed control system that can provide more accurate speed adjustment under different processing conditions. Some high-end equipment is also equipped with an automated speed adjustment system that can automatically optimize the speed according to the real-time monitoring of the cutting data to ensure that it always runs in a better state. For some old or low-end equipment, the operator needs to manually adjust the speed, especially under complex processing conditions, and needs to be particularly careful to avoid affecting the cutting effect.
